The Coursera course ‘Interventions and Calibration’ offers an excellent opportunity for students and professionals to deepen their understanding of these vital topics.
This course provides a comprehensive overview of modeling infectious diseases, building on the classic SIR model. Participants will learn how to incorporate additional compartments to simulate the effects of various interventions, such as vaccination—covering concepts like ‘leaky’ vaccines and different treatment effects. One of the course highlights is its practical approach to data-model calibration. Starting with basic models, learners are guided through calibration techniques, including manual calibration, least-squares, and maximum-likelihood methods, with practical exercises in R.
